Blink
An IDL compiler written in Luau for ROBLOX buffer networking
Performance
Blink aims to generate the most performant and bandwidth-efficient code for your specific experience, but what does this mean?
It means lower bandwidth usage directly resulting in lower ping* experienced by players and secondly, it means lower CPU usage compared to more generalized networking solutions.
* In comparison to standard ROBLOX networking, this may not always be the case but should never result in increased ping times.
Benchmarks are available here here (opens in a new tab).
Security
Blink does two things to combat bad actors:
- Data sent by clients will be validated on the receiving side before reaching any critical game code.
- As a result of the compression done by Blink it becomes significantly harder to snoop on your game's network traffic. Long gone are the days of skids using RemoteSpy to snoop on your game's traffic.
Get Started
Head over to the installation page to get started with Blink!